Placidium imbecillum (Breuss) Breuss

Ann. naturhist. Mus. Wien, 98B: 41, 1996. Basionym: Catapyrenium imbecillum Breuss - Stapfia, 23: 80, 1990.
Synonyms:
Distribution: S - Cal (Puntillo 1996).
Description: Thallus squamulose, brownish, dull to somewhat shiny, the squamules 2-5 mm broad, 190-380 μm thick, rounded to mostly undulate, concave to flattened, smooth, with an up-turned edge. Lower surface black, brown at the periphery, attached by colourless, 5-6 μm thick rhizohyphae. Upper cortex paraplectenchymatous, 28-88 μm thick, with or without an epinecral layer; medulla prosoplectenchymatous, 30-107 μm thick, of 3-5 μm thick, elongated cells; lower cortex clearly delimited from the medulla, (20-)40-85 μm thick, of roundish to angular, irregularly arranged, 6-16 μm wide cells. Perithecia frequent, laminal, pyriform, immersed in the squamules, up to 0.4 mm wide, without involucrellum. Exciple pale throughout; paraphyses absent, substituted by periphyses; hymenium K/I+ blue. Asci 8-spored, cylindrical, thin-walled, non-amyloid and without an ocular chamber. Ascospores 1-celled, hyaline, ellipsoid, thin-walled, uniseriately arranged in the asci, (12-)14-18(-20) x 6-8 μm. Pycnidia marginal, poorly evident. Conidia bacilliform, 3-6 x 0.5-1.5 μm. Photobiont chlorococcoid. Spot tests: cortex and medulla K-, C-, KC-, P-, UV-. Chemistry: without lichen substances.
Note: a terricolous species known from the Austrian Alps and from several isolated stations in southern Europe, with optimum near and above treeline; to be looked for in the Alps.
Growth form: Squamulose
Substrata: soil, terricolous mosses, and plant debris
Photobiont: green algae other than Trentepohlia
Reproductive strategy: mainly sexual

Commonnes-rarity: (info)

Alpine belt: very rare
Subalpine belt: very rare
Oromediterranean belt: very rare
Montane belt: absent
Submediterranean belt: absent
Padanian area: absent
Humid submediterranean belt: absent
Humid mediterranean belt: absent
Dry mediterranean belt: absent
